History:
Harleen Quinzel had a reasonable enough childhood growing up in a lower class family in Brooklyn New York. The eldest daughter with three younger brothers it was always a challenge for her to find time to study, but she threw herself into those books with a passion because she knew one day she wanted out of that house! Her parents were less then supportive in her efforts but in their own way they helped because she was determined to prove them wrong and become a success.
 
Her first love came in the form of a young boy named Bernie whom she met at a Halloween Party. Bernie didn't think like other boys, he didn't treat her like a weird freak for her obsession with psychology and the criminal mind. In fact Bernie cared for her so much that he found a girl who had been bullying Harley and shoved her into the path of an oncoming truck. Harley fell in love, Bernie went to juvie. She was heartbroken when she found out he was stabbed and killed in lock up. The only souvenir she has of their time together is a taxidermied beaver she stole from his house.
 
Graduating college with honors, the young Dr. Quinzell took one of the most challenging positions a psychiatrist could, working at Arkham Asylum for the criminally insane. When even she found it challenging to get the patients to open up to her, she went undercover among the population disguised as one of them. Only one criminal recognized her however, the sociopathic clown known only as "The Joker".
 
The Joker seduced her, charmed her, and wound her around her finger with his sense of humor and manipulative ways. Eventually the warden was murdered and when the new warden found out about Quinn's project and her obsession, he fired her. This resulted in her breaking the Joker out of his cell and the two of them fleeing into the night together. She was so over the moon about being free of her responsibilities and running wild with him, that she only had second thoughts when he took her to a chemical processing plant and wanted to throw her in a vat to make her more like him. She struggled, he won and chucked her in. The result was her skin became bleached white, her hair stained to the roots in black and red, and her mind fractured. Harley Quinn was born.
 
Just as quickly as their romance had begun, the Joker abandoned his new creation, leaving poor Harley despondent and directionless. A boon would come in the form of a brownstone apartment building on Coney Island that was left to her by a previous patient. She set off for her new life right away with only a few meager possessions and her stuffed beaver. 
 
Life in New York hasn't been easy by far, but it has been good for Harley. She hopes to continue her progress in Waverly Bay. 

Personality:
In Harley Quinn's mind, she is a superhero. Sure she maims, brutalizes and straight up murders some people but it's all in good fun isn't it?
 
Harley Quinzel was once a respectable, cunning, ambitious woman who at times took herself too seriously. But the value of love and laughter was taught to her at a young age. Once her emotions were warped and twisted by the Joker she buried the more serious aspects of her personality in favor of a light hearted goofball personality, utterly devoted to those she has grown fond of. 
 
Unflinchingly loyal, Harley's masochistic personality allows her to throw herself headlong into the face of danger laughing all the way, especially if a friend is in need. It can be this overenthusiastic attitude towards chaos however that leads her to take things too far at times. However more often then not she acts as the butt of a joke so that no one else has to feel bad. And while some may perceive her as a ditz, it is a dangerous mistake to under estimate her.
 
Shockingly brilliant at times, Harley has shown herself capable of outwitting, outmatching and out lasting some of Gotham's biggest and baddest, including befuddling and pestering Batman himself. However when she takes a position as sidekick (Something she has grown accustomed to) she tends fall on her face more and be more easily dispatched. Whenever she gets knocked down though she does her best to laugh at herself and spring back to her feet.
 
Of note is Harley's madness and addiction to the Joker being major weakness. Even she admits that he's not good for her, but in his presence if he's aiming to charm her there's little she can do to resist the siren call of fun, chaos and mayhem. She is deeply in love with the Joker despite the abusive nature of his relationship, and despite being well aware of how dangerous it is for her she can't help but want to help him.
 
Harley is motivated by any number of things, a need for fun and excitement, a love for life and love. She's taken to not only reaching for the things she wants out of life but trying to blow it all up into something even bigger and better.
 
She's not necessarily a bad person, she's just got a sliding scale of morality. While she'd never hurt an innocent kid she's not above knocking Robin with an oversized mallet. She's been known to drag people behind her motorcycle for abusing their dogs, or kidnap and threaten entire families because she thought they weren't visiting their grandmother enough. At one point she even murdered a defenseless old man on a breathing machine because her friend insisted that in the prime of his life he had been a filthy communist spy. While she can occasionally be selfish or thoughtless, she is often compassionate to a fault. 
 
So maybe in the end she's not so much a superhero, not even an anti-hero so much as an anti-villain? Is that a thing? She might try to make it a thing.
